Originally posted by: JasonCoder
So essentially they got a custom tune and added a CAI to produce 540HP? That's sick. People... don't feel the pressure to lay down $90k+ just to have a cobra/SVT badge on your car. Buy a stock GT and mod from there. Yes SVT, Shelby, etc. make nice mods but so can you.

With bolt ons you can probably add 40 HP to the stock GT. With a supercharger, probably close to 500 HP, but you'll also need to replace quite a few things and probably get some forged internals. So you can probably get 500 HP for GT base price + $10k if you install everything yourself. I paid around $30k for my fully upgraded GT, so $40k total would give me something similar to the performance of a Shelby, minus the appearance mods.
